How Do Smart Contracts Work?

How Do Smart Contracts Work?

Smart contracts are self-executing digital agreements that run on blockchain technology. They work by automating the execution and enforcement of predefined conditions and actions without the need for intermediaries. To understand how smart contracts work, let’s break down the process:

Creation

  • Smart contracts are created using programming languages specifically designed for blockchain platforms. For example, Ethereum, one of the most popular blockchain platforms for smart contracts, uses a language called Solidity.
  • The contract’s terms and conditions are coded into the smart contract. These terms can cover various agreements, such as financial transactions, supply chain operations, legal agreements, and more.

Deployment

  • Once the smart contract is coded and tested, it is deployed onto a blockchain platform. The most common platform for smart contracts is Ethereum, although others like Binance Smart Chain, Cardano, and Polkadot also support them.
  • The smart contract is stored on the blockchain, and its code becomes immutable, meaning it cannot be altered once deployed. This immutability ensures that the terms of the contract remain tamper-proof.

Execution

  • Smart contracts rely on predefined conditions, also known as “if-then” statements. These conditions are specified in the contract’s code.
  • When the conditions are met, the smart contract self-executes without the need for human intervention. For example, if the contract is a payment agreement, the contract will automatically release the payment to the specified recipient when the conditions are fulfilled.

Verification and Consensus

  • Smart contracts run on a decentralized network of computers (nodes) that validate and record transactions. These nodes reach consensus to ensure the accuracy of transactions.
  • Once a transaction triggers a smart contract, it is broadcast to the network for validation. The majority of nodes on the network must agree that the transaction is valid for it to be added to the blockchain.

Read Also: The Ultimate Smart Contract Developer Roadmap

Recording Transactions

  • All transactions related to a smart contract are recorded on the blockchain. This creates an immutable and transparent ledger of all activities associated with the contract.
  • Users can access the blockchain to verify transactions and view the contract’s history, providing a high level of transparency and security.

User Interaction

  • Users interact with smart contracts by sending transactions to the contract’s address on the blockchain. These transactions include data and instructions.
  • The smart contract processes these interactions according to its predefined code.

Payment and Gas Fees

  • In most blockchain networks, including Ethereum, executing smart contracts requires a fee known as “gas.” Gas fees are paid in cryptocurrency and cover the computational resources needed to execute the contract.
  • For example, when you send a transaction to a smart contract, you’ll need to include a certain amount of cryptocurrency to cover the gas fees.

In summary, smart contracts work by encoding the terms and actions of an agreement into self-executing, tamper-proof code. They are deployed on a blockchain network, where they automatically execute when predefined conditions are met. This automation eliminates the need for intermediaries, enhances security, and increases the efficiency and transparency of agreements and transactions.

Challenges and Concerns in Combining Smart Contracts and IoT

Challenges and Concerns in Combining Smart Contracts and IoT

While the convergence of Smart Contracts and the Internet of Things (IoT) offers numerous benefits, it also presents several challenges and concerns that need to be addressed for successful implementation. Here are some of the key challenges and concerns in combining these two transformative technologies:

  • Scalability: As IoT networks expand and the number of devices increases, scalability becomes a significant concern. Ensuring that the blockchain network can handle a growing volume of transactions and smart contracts is a technical challenge.
  • Interoperability: IoT devices often use different communication protocols and standards. Ensuring compatibility and interoperability between these devices and blockchain platforms can be complex.
  • Data Privacy: Smart Contracts on a public blockchain are inherently transparent, and this transparency may conflict with data privacy regulations, especially in sensitive sectors like healthcare. Striking a balance between transparency and data privacy is a concern.
  • Security Vulnerabilities: While blockchain technology enhances security, it is not immune to vulnerabilities. Smart contracts are at risk of exploitation if not coded and audited correctly. IoT devices can also be vulnerable to cyberattacks, and combining them with smart contracts introduces additional risks.
  • Legal and Regulatory Challenges: The legal and regulatory landscape for Smart Contracts and IoT is still evolving. Compliance with existing and emerging regulations can be complex, particularly in industries like finance, healthcare, and transportation.

Read Also: Importance of Economic & Game Theory Audits in Smart Contracts

  • Oracles: Smart Contracts require real-world data to function effectively, which is provided by oracles. The accuracy and reliability of oracles are crucial, and there is a need to address the trustworthiness of data sources.
  • User Adoption: The integration of these technologies may require changes in user behavior and business processes. Achieving user adoption and ensuring that users can effectively interact with these systems is a significant concern.
  • Energy Consumption: Many blockchain networks, such as Ethereum, rely on energy-intensive consensus mechanisms like Proof of Work. This can raise concerns about the environmental impact and sustainability of such systems, particularly when applied to IoT devices with limited power resources.
  • Complexity: Combining Smart Contracts and IoT can introduce a level of complexity that may be challenging for developers, businesses, and end-users to navigate and manage.
  • Reliability: The reliability of IoT devices can vary, and not all devices are created equal. Ensuring that smart contracts can trust the data generated by these devices and the actions they take is a concern.

PTC

PTC

PTC Inc. was a computer software and services firm based in Boston, Massachusetts, formed in 1985. In 1988, the business started creating parametric, associative feature-based, solid computer-aided design (CAD) modeling software, followed in 1998 by an Internet-based application for product lifecycle management (PLM).

Internet of things (IoT), augmented reality (AR), and collaboration software are among PTC’s products and services. They also provide consulting, implementation, and training services.

PTC is an industrial IoT technology partner that assists businesses in navigating the ever-changing digital technology ecosystem and accelerating their digital transformation activities. PTC provides a range of product lifecycle management, CAD, augmented reality, and IoT solutions to customers to increase business continuity.

First of all, we need to know two real-life IoT security breaches which have had harmful effects on mainstream businesses.

  • The Mirai Botnet

In 2016, an IoT, ‘botnet’ took the benefits of openness in TV cameras and routers. After scanning the internet for Telnet ports, it had been found that the botnet had done force-hack its way into the system by using the device’s 61 default credentials. Though this particular attack was restricted to internet-connected TV cameras and routers, the attacks of brute-force can influence any other IoT device.

  • Connected Cars

Due to the advancements in car technology, by 2025 Ford Motors are expecting to offer driverless vehicles to the market. These superior-quality IoT devices will give more convenience to users by helping them to avoid accidents and manage a wide range of safety technologies, from anti-lock brakes to airbags. But according to security firm Trend Micro, these safety systems are even more vulnerable to hacking and the hack attacks the network protocol known as the Controller Area Network, or CAN. Thus, everything of the car, connected to CAN will be hacked and may give rise to a potential threat.
